A3. Information we collect
We collect only what is necessary to deliver the Aran service:
- Phone number — used to identify your account and route call-screening to your device.
- SIM hardware identifier (hashed) — a one-way cryptographic hash of your SIM ICCID, used for device authentication. The raw ICCID is never stored on our servers.
- Google account identifier (sub) — the unique numeric ID from your Google account, collected only if you choose to link your account via the web portal. We do not store your Google name or email on our servers.
- Device model name — e.g. "Samsung Galaxy S24", sent during enrolment and displayed in the web portal so you can identify your protected devices.
- Call screening records — when the Guardian Agent answers a call on your behalf, we store metadata (caller number last 4 digits, timestamp, AI-assessed spam score, intent category) and the transcript of the conversation. These are used to show you a screening summary and to improve model accuracy.
- Call audio — audio from screened calls is temporarily buffered during the screening session for real-time speech recognition. It is not retained after the call ends.
We do not collect your contacts, SMS messages, browsing history, or any data unrelated to call screening.
A4. Third-party services
Aran relies on the following third-party services to function:
- Google Cloud Speech-to-Text — real-time transcription of caller audio during screening sessions. Audio is sent to Google's API and subject to Google Cloud's privacy notice.
- Google Cloud Text-to-Speech — synthesis of the Guardian Agent's spoken responses.
- Google Gemini API — AI reasoning used to assess caller intent and generate screening responses.
- Google Sign-In (optional) — used only if you choose to link your Google account for web-portal access.
- Firebase Cloud Messaging (FCM) — push notifications used to deliver screening results to your device.
- Exotel — telephony platform used to receive and bridge calls in India.
Each of these services operates under its own privacy policy. We encourage you to review them.

A6. Data security
- All API communication is encrypted in transit using TLS 1.2 or higher.
- Your SIM identifier is stored as a one-way cryptographic hash (SHA-256); the original value cannot be recovered from our database.
- The Aran app uses Android's hardware-backed Trusted Execution Environment (TEE / StrongBox) to generate and store cryptographic keys that cannot be exported or cloned.
- FIDO2 biometric attestation is required for sensitive operations such as call approval and re-enrolment.
No security system is perfect. During the beta period, you acknowledge that residual risks exist and that Vaayil Technologies cannot guarantee the absolute security of data transmitted over the internet.
